Understanding Embedded Software Systems

Firmware

Firmware is the low-level software programmed into the embedded system and is often stored in read-only memory (ROM). In simple words, firmware is a set of instructions that tells a device how to operate. It’s like the brain of the device that controls its basic functions. For example, it makes sure your phone can turn on or connect to WI-FI. Updating the firmware can improve the device’s performance without changing the hardware.

Device Drivers

Device drivers are like a communication bridge between the operating system and the hardware. They make sure the hardware can understand the instructions given by the operating system. Because of this flow, all components of the system can perfectly work together. The embedded systems depend a lot on efficient and reliable drivers for optimal performance.

Real-Time Operating Systems (RTOS)

A Real-Time Operating System (RTOS) can handle tasks that require precise timing. Compared to general-purpose operating systems, an RTOS can perform instructions within strict deadlines. This is perfect for apps where timing is crucial like medical devices and automotive systems. RTOSs make sure that high-priority tasks get immediate attention and lower-priority tasks are done later. As an example, RTOSs make sure the airbag opens right at the time of the car crash.

Middleware

Middleware is another type of software system that sits between the operating system and the applications. It helps to manage communication and data exchange, making different parts of a system work together seamlessly.  For example, a smart house has various devices like smart thermostats, lights, and sensors. Middleware is the manager that helps these devices communicate with the main control system. It makes sure that information from the sensors reaches the main system correctly. And if you want to change something, like the temperature, it sends the right instructions to the devices.

Consumer Electronics

You can find embedded software in everyday devices like smartwatches, smart home devices, and washing machines. The embedded systems in smartwatches include things like sensors, processors, and wireless connectivity. They help track health data, show notifications, and interact with your phone.

In smart home devices, embedded software integrations are used for sensors, actuators, and communication modules. They automate and control different home functions. Smart lighting systems can adjust brightness based on ambient light conditions and user preferences.

At the same time, washing machines have embedded controllers built into them. With their help, the washing machine can regulate washing cycles, manage water levels, and regulate spin speeds. Sensors can detect the amount of laundry, and the system adjusts settings to optimize the wash.

Automotive Systems

It’s hard to imagine modern vehicles without embedded systems. They are used for engine control, infotainment systems, and advanced driver-assistance systems (ADAS). With these functions, you can have a safer and more automatic driving experience.

Software in cars handles braking, steering, and acceleration. So it must follow strict safety and performance rules. ADAS features use data from sensors and cameras in real time. This helps with lane-keeping, adaptive cruise control, and automated parking.

Infotainment systems in vehicles make features like navigation, entertainment, and connectivity possible. With their help, you can connect smartphones and cloud services to your vehicle. Embedded software makes sure these functions are smooth and uninterrupted.

Medical Devices

Medical Devices (1)

Embedded software is crucial in the healthcare industry, where accuracy and reliability are vital. It manages equipment like pacemakers, insulin pumps, and diagnostic machines.

For instance, a pacemaker’s software monitors the heartbeat. It then sends signals to maintain a steady rhythm. But this software must be tested first to avoid errors or interference.

MRI scanners and blood analyzers also use embedded software. This software processes and analyzes data. In MRI scanners, it controls magnetic fields and other components to make body images. These tasks need powerful software to handle that much data and complex algorithms.

Industrial Control Systems

In industrial settings, embedded software plays a critical role in industrial machinery, robotics, and process automation. These systems increase efficiency, reduce downtime, and enhance safety, contributing to more productive and safer industrial operations.

Embedded software in industrial control systems must be highly reliable and capable of real-time operation, as any mistake can lead to expensive downtime or safety risks. For instance, programmable logic controllers (PLCs) use embedded software to monitor and control manufacturing processes, ensuring precise timing and coordination of various tasks.

Robotic systems in manufacturing rely on embedded software for a wide range of functions. They include controlling movements, managing sensors, and executing complex tasks with high precision. This software integration makes sure robots can perform repetitive and dangerous tasks, improving productivity and safety in industrial environments.

The Rise of Biometric Authentication

As mobile applications handle more sensitive data, the need for robust security measures has never been greater. One of the most significant developments in mobile application security is the rise of biometric authentication. This technology uses exclusive physical characteristics, like facial recognition, fingerprints, and also iris scans, to verify a user’s identity. Biometric authentication is gaining popularity because it offers a greater degree of security compared to conventional methods such as PINS and even passwords.

Passwords can be guessed, stolen, or forgotten. However, biometric data is unique to each individual, making it much harder for unauthorized users to gain access. Additionally, the integration of biometric authentication in mobile applications enhances user convenience. It allows quick and seamless access to services without compromising security.

The increasing demand for secure mobile transactions also drives the adoption of biometric authentication. As more users rely on mobile devices for banking, shopping, and other sensitive activities, the need for advanced security measures has become paramount. Biometric authentication provides an additional layer of protection. This ensures that even if a device is lost or stolen, the user’s data remains secure.

Moreover, advancements in biometric technology are making these methods more reliable and accessible. For instance, facial recognition software has improved significantly in recent years, reducing the chances of false positives and enhancing accuracy.  As a result, more mobile applications are incorporating biometric authentication as a standard security feature.

The Growing Need for End-to-End Encryption

End-to-End Encryption (1)

Another critical trend in mobile application security is the growing need for end-to-end encryption. With the increasing amount of personal and financial information being transmitted through mobile apps, ensuring that data is securely encrypted has become a top priority. End-to-end encryption guarantees that data is encrypted on the sender’s device and can only be decrypted by the intended recipient. This means that even if the data is extracted during transmission, it can’t be read by any unauthorized parties. This level of security is essential for messaging apps, financial services, and any application that handles sensitive information.

Rising concerns over privacy and data breaches have further fueled the push for end-to-end encryption. Users are becoming more aware of the risks associated with using mobile applications and are demanding better protection for their data. As a result, developers are increasingly implementing end-to-end encryption to meet these demands and build trust with their users.

The Impact of Artificial Intelligence on Security

Artificial Intelligence (AI) is playing an increasingly important role in mobile application security. AI technologies are being used to enhance security measures, detect vulnerabilities, and respond to threats more effectively. The use of AI in cybersecurity is helping to keep pace with the rapidly evolving threat landscape. One of the primary ways AI is being used in mobile application security is through the detection of anomalies and potential threats. Machine learning algorithms can analyze vast amounts of data to identify patterns and behaviors that may indicate a security breach.

For example, AI can detect unusual login attempts, irregular data access patterns, or unexpected changes in application behavior, allowing for quick response to potential threats. AI is also being used to improve threat intelligence. By analyzing data from various sources, AI systems can provide real-time insights into emerging threats. They help organizations stay ahead of cybercriminals. This proactive approach to security allows developers to patch vulnerabilities before they can be exploited and implement countermeasures to prevent attacks.

Furthermore, AI is enhancing user authentication processes by adding an extra layer of security. For instance, AI-powered behavioral biometrics can analyze how a user interacts with their device. This includes typing speed or swiping patterns, to verify their  identity. This technology can detect if someone other than the authorized user is trying to access the application, triggering additional security measures.
